Patient and Graft Outcomes from Deceased Kidney Donors Age 70 Years and Older: An Analysis of th Organ Procurement Transplant Network/United Network o
Transplantation. 85(11): 1573-1579, 2008
The organ shortage has resulted in more use of older deceased donor kidneys. Data are limited on the impact of donor aged 70 years and older on transplant outcomes. We examined patient and graft outcomes of renal transplant from expanded criteria donors (ECDs) aged 70 years and older, using the Organ Procurement Transplant Network/United Network of Organ Sharing database.
